Transaction ef3b0f71e1103350d2fd69ccbe990b6a5c852129e364c1757c698ed70b4025f4

2 Input
1 Outputs
  • ef3b0f71e1103350d2fd69ccbe990b6a5c852129e364c1757c698ed70b4025f4:0
  • value  3478753
    address  3GpweNBxcMfWrsS1gf2JeSyjUVisd5aJ4J